Transaction 64309c32aa927ced3c48f07d4b64e63dd034d593d8d7819c77b2c71757d3e7df

1 Input
2 Outputs
  • 64309c32aa927ced3c48f07d4b64e63dd034d593d8d7819c77b2c71757d3e7df:0
  • value  1443526
    address  18jvFRvtRnDNB8W2zrCdeUjdyAAJxyXTvF
  • 64309c32aa927ced3c48f07d4b64e63dd034d593d8d7819c77b2c71757d3e7df:1
  • value  510000
    address  3PmnMsQsMYkHo77TBhyBExtsu2T31KAAb3